What eye care services are typically available from optometrists in the Fowlerville area?

Optometrists in Fowlerville and the surrounding Livingston County area typically offer comprehensive eye exams, contact lens fittings (including for astigmatism and presbyopia), diagnosis and management of conditions like dry eye and glaucoma, and prescriptions for glasses. Given the rural nature of the area, some practices may also have strong connections with optical labs for timely eyewear. For specialized surgical care, such as cataract surgery, they will refer patients to ophthalmologists in larger nearby hubs like Brighton or Lansing.

Do optometrists in Fowlerville accept my vision or medical insurance?

Most optometry practices in Fowlerville accept major vision insurance plans like VSP, EyeMed, and Davis Vision, as well as medical insurance (e.g., Blue Cross Blue Shield of Michigan, Medicare) for medically necessary visits. It's crucial to call the specific office ahead of your appointment, as acceptance can vary. Some smaller, independent practices in the area might also offer competitive self-pay rates or in-house vision plans for patients without insurance.

First, understand the types of eye doctors available. An optometrist (OD) is your primary eye care provider, performing comprehensive eye exams, prescribing glasses and contact lenses, and managing conditions like dry eye or glaucoma. An ophthalmologist (MD) is a medical doctor who can perform surgery and treat complex eye diseases. For most Fowlerville residents seeking routine care, a local optometrist is the perfect starting point. Consider what you need: a routine check-up, management of a specific condition like diabetes (which requires diligent monitoring), or a specialist for children's eye exams as they head back to school.
